Phage transcriptional regulator X (PtrX)-mediated augmentation of toxin production and virulence in <i>Clostridioides difficile</i> strain R20291

Clostridioides difficile is a Gram-positive, anaerobic, and spore-forming bacterial member of the human gut microbiome. The primary virulence factors of C. difficile are toxin A and toxin B. These toxins damage the cell cytoskeleton and cause various diseases, from diarrhea to severe pseudomembranous colitis.
